Injured cyclist airlifted to Victoria hospital

NANAIMO - A cyclist is still in hospital after being discovered at the side of the road in Cedar.


An injured cyclist is still in hospital after being found unconscious at the side of the road in Cedar.

Nanaimo RCMP says it was alerted by B.C. Ambulance at 3:15 p.m. Friday afternoon about a female lying on the shoulder of Akenhead Road, near Tees Avenue, next to her bicycle, with no identification.

“It appeared for unknown reasons, she lost control of her bike and fell off it, onto the roadway. It is unknown if she collided with another motor vehicle or moving object as the bike had minimal damage. She was attended to by B.C. paramedics and later airlifted to Victoria General Hospital,” said Const. Gary O'Brien, Nanaimo RCMP spokesman, in a press release.

The police are seeking information on events leading up to the woman's injuries. Anyone with information is asked to call Nanaimo RCMP at 250-754-2345.
